Syllabus

BUENO, 21 I&N Dec. 1029 (BIA 1997) ID 3328 (PDF) (1) In order to qualify as the legitimated child of the petitioner under section 101(b)(1)(C) of the Immigration and Nationality Act, 8 U.S.C. § 1101(b)(1)(C) (1994), the beneficiary must be the biological child of the petitioner. (2) A delayed birth certificate does not necessarily offer conclusive evidence of paternity even if it is unrebutted by contradictory evidence it must instead be evaluated in light of the other evidence of record and the circumstances of the case.
